QuickSwitch® Products High-Speed CMOS QuickSwitch MultiWidth24:6 Mux/Demux DESCRIPTION QS33X253 QS33X2253 Enhanced channel with inherent diode Bidirectional switches connect inputs ouputs 24:6 Mux/Demux switches Zero propagation delay, zero ground bounce Individual controls each bank Undershoot clamp diodes switch control pins TTL-compatible control inputs Available 48-pin QVSOP (Q1) QS33X2253 version noise APPLICATIONS Logic replacement Video, audio, graphics switching, muxing Hot-swapping, hot-docking (Application Note AN-13) Voltage translation 3.3V; Application Note AN-11) QS33X253 high-speed CMOS 24:6 dual 4:1) multiplexer/demultiplexer. QS33X253 member MultiWidthfamily functionally compatible three QuickSwitch version 74F253, 74FCT253, 74ALS/AS/LS253 Dual multiplexers. resistance QS33X253 allows inputs connected outputs without adding propagation delay without generating additional ground bounce noise. TTL-compatible control circuitry with "Break-before-make" feature avoids contention demux side. This part ideal video switching four memory bank interleaving applications. QS33X2253 series resistors reduce ground bounce noise. Mux/Demux devices provide order magnitude faster speed than equivalent logic devices. This parameter guaranteed, production tested. switch contributes propagation delay other than delay resistance switch load capacitance. time constant switch alone order 0.25ns QS33X253 1.25ns QS33X2253 50pF. Since this time constant much smaller than rise/fall times typical driving signals, adds very little propagation delay system. Propagation delay switch when used system determined driving circuit driving side switch interaction with load driven side. QUALITY SEMICONDUCTOR, INC.
